Shakespeare Comes to Cheltenham Poetry Festival!

Well not actually Shakespeare, but Dr Chris Laoutaris the author of a best selling book on the Bard - 'Shakespeare's Book The Intertwined Lives Behind the First Folio'. Dr Chris is Associate Professor at the Shakespeare Institute in Stratford-Upon-Avon.

The New York Journal of Books said “Shakespeare’s Book by Chris Laoutaris is a must read for anyone with even a slight passing fancy for Shakespeare. It is not about William Shakespeare, per se, but details how the First Folio came into being.”
This talk is a must-hear talk!

When Shakespeare died, his plays had not been published. It is only because a group of his friends and admirers published the First Folio that Shakespeare’s reputation and legacy was secured. On the Bard's birthday find out about the fascinating story behind the book.

The event will be chaired by Jo Durrant, the award-winning presenter of the independent arts and science podcast Jo's Beautiful Universe.
